010-53388338

数据备份全攻略:从目标到实操,构建高可用、低成本、安全合规体系

分类:IT频道 时间:2026-03-03 07:10 浏览:59
概述
    一、数据备份核心目标  1.业务连续性保障:确保系统故障、灾难或人为错误时,数据可快速恢复,减少停机时间。  2.合规性要求:满足《网络安全法》《数据安全法》等法规对数据留存和隐私保护的要求。  3.成本优化:平衡备份频率、存储成本与恢复效率,避免资源浪费。    二、数据分类与备份优先级 
内容
  
   一、数据备份核心目标
  1. 业务连续性保障:确保系统故障、灾难或人为错误时,数据可快速恢复,减少停机时间。
  2. 合规性要求:满足《网络安全法》《数据安全法》等法规对数据留存和隐私保护的要求。
  3. 成本优化:平衡备份频率、存储成本与恢复效率,避免资源浪费。
  
   二、数据分类与备份优先级
  根据数据敏感性和业务影响,划分备份等级:
  | 数据类型 | 示例 | 备份频率 | 保留周期 | 恢复优先级 |
  |--------------------|-----------------------------|-------------|-------------|----------------|
  | 核心业务数据 | 订单、库存、支付记录 | 实时/分钟级 | 90天+ | 最高 |
  | 运营数据 | 用户行为、物流轨迹 | 小时级 | 30天 | 高 |
  | 配置数据 | 系统参数、权限设置 | 日级 | 180天 | 中 |
  | 日志数据 | 操作日志、审计记录 | 日级 | 365天 | 低 |
  
   三、备份策略设计
   1. 备份方式选择
  - 全量备份:每周一次,完整复制所有数据,作为恢复基准。
  - 增量备份:每日执行,仅备份自上次备份后的变更数据,节省存储空间。
  - 差异备份:可选方案,备份自上次全量备份后的所有变更,恢复时需合并全量+差异备份。
  - 实时同步:对核心数据库(如MySQL、MongoDB)启用主从复制或分布式一致性协议(如Raft),实现近实时数据冗余。
  
   2. 备份存储架构
  - 本地存储:部署在企业级NAS或SAN设备中,作为一级恢复源,满足RTO(恢复时间目标)<2小时的需求。
  - 云存储:选择AWS S3、阿里云OSS等对象存储服务,实现异地容灾,保留至少3份副本,防止区域性灾难。
  - 磁带库:对历史数据(如超过1年的日志)进行离线归档,降低长期存储成本。
  
   3. 加密与安全
  - 传输加密:使用SSL/TLS协议加密备份数据传输通道。
  - 存储加密:采用AES-256算法对备份文件进行加密,密钥管理通过KMS(密钥管理系统)实现。
  - 访问控制:基于RBAC模型限制备份操作权限,记录所有访问日志。
  
   四、技术实现方案
   1. 数据库备份工具
  - MySQL:使用`mysqldump`(逻辑备份)或Percona XtraBackup(物理备份)实现热备份。
  - MongoDB:通过`mongodump`或`mongorestore`工具支持分片集群备份。
  - Redis:利用RDB快照+AOF日志实现持久化,结合`redis-rdb-bgsave`进行异步备份。
  
   2. 文件系统备份
  - Linux:使用`rsync`或`BorgBackup`实现增量文件备份,支持去重和压缩。
  - Windows:通过VSS(卷影复制服务)实现应用一致性备份。
  
   3. 自动化编排
  - 定时任务:通过Cron或Windows Task Scheduler调度备份脚本。
  - 工作流引擎:使用Apache Airflow或Jenkins构建备份流水线,集成监控告警。
  
   五、恢复测试与演练
  1. 定期恢复测试:每季度模拟数据丢失场景,验证备份文件的完整性和可恢复性。
  2. 灾难恢复演练:每年至少一次全链路灾备演练,包括:
   - 切换至备用数据中心;
   - 恢复核心业务系统;
   - 验证订单处理、库存同步等关键流程。
  3. RTO/RPO评估:根据测试结果调整备份策略,确保RTO(恢复时间目标)<4小时,RPO(恢复点目标)<15分钟。
  
   六、运维管理规范
  1. 备份日志审计:记录每次备份的开始时间、结束时间、数据量及状态(成功/失败)。
  2. 存储空间监控:设置阈值告警,防止因存储空间不足导致备份中断。
  3. 过期数据清理:自动删除超过保留周期的备份文件,避免资源浪费。
  4. 人员培训:定期对运维团队进行备份恢复操作培训,确保应急响应能力。
  
   七、成本优化建议
  - 冷热数据分离:将高频访问数据存储在SSD,低频数据迁移至廉价硬盘或云冷存储。
  - 压缩与去重:使用Zstandard或LZ4算法压缩备份文件,减少存储占用。
  - 云资源弹性伸缩:在备份高峰期临时扩展云存储带宽,避免长期预留资源。
  
   八、典型场景应对
  - 数据库损坏:通过全量+增量备份恢复至最近一致点,结合二进制日志(binlog)回滚未提交事务。
  - 区域性灾难:切换至异地云存储,通过CDN加速恢复核心业务数据。
  - 勒索软件攻击:隔离受感染系统,从离线备份中恢复数据,避免支付赎金。
  
  通过上述方案,美菜生鲜可构建高可用、低成本、合规安全的数据备份体系,有效抵御各类数据风险,支撑业务持续稳定发展。
评论
  • 下一篇

  • Fatal error: Allowed memory size of 134217728 bytes exhausted (tried to allocate 8192 bytes) in /www/wwwroot/www.sjwxsc.com/config/function.php on line 274